1. INCLUSIVE CALLS/SMS - up to the all-inclusive volume of 100 units, domestically and within Europe. 1 unit = 1 SMS = 1 voice call minute.
Calls/SMS from the POST mobile network to a landline number or a domestic mobile network, or calling voicemail, incoming calls/SMS from a network in Europe, outgoing calls from a country in Europe to a landline or mobile number on a European network, outgoing calls from a European country to a voicemail number. Excluding special numbers, calls to voice-over-internet numbers and data, fax and video calling
SMS and MMS: When sending an SMS or MMS to multiple recipients, an SMS or MMS respectively will be billed for each recipient, as applicable. The maximum size of an MMS is technically limited to 200 KB. Up to 5,000 MMS to mobile numbers in Luxembourg from the POST mobile network or on roaming in Europe. Receiving SMS and MMS: SMS and MMS are free to receive from the POST mobile network.
The term "Europe" refers to zone 1 of the list shown in the appendix and the term "European" to a country in zone 1 of this list. The units used to and from Europe are deducted from plans in the order in which the billing data sent by foreign operators are processed POST Telecom SA, depending on the technical constraints inherent in the billing system and the date of receipt of these data; POST Telecom SA cannot guarantee that this order will match the chronological order in which the communications are made. In general, it is free to receive an SMS on a foreign mobile network. However, some operators may apply a charge for receipt, which will be recharged to the client. To receive MMS from a foreign mobile network, additional charges for packet switching or circuit switching type data communications shall be billed (tariffs and roaming agreements available online).

The customer has the option to request the cancellation of the Guarantee+ option without giving a reason, by sending a letter via registered mail with return receipt addressed to POST Telecom SA, 1 rue Emile Bian, L-1235 Luxembourg. The cancellation of an option will only take effect at the end of the month of receipt by POST Telecom SA of the cancellation letter sent by the customer. See the special terms and conditions applicable to Guarantee+.
4. The customer can purchase an option by sending an SMS to 64000 or via MyPost, which will allow them to monitor their usage. It is possible to take out options in different categories at the same time (e.g. USA/Canada for data + USA/Canada for Calls & SMS). The previous option must have been used in full before the customer can purchase an option in the same category. The customer will be notified by SMS when it comes to purchasing options and monitoring their usage (100%). Around the World option billing rate: Data per KB - Calls per second (1"/1")
